Graeme Rayner is a stand-up comedian from Dewsbury, West Yorkshire, who made his debut in November 2018 after completing a stand-up course, something he had always wanted to do but never quite dared until he did it in memory of his late mother. Since then he has become one of the more prolific and well-travelled acts on the circuit, a veteran of ten Edinburgh Fringes with festival credits that stretch from Glastonbury's Legendary Cabaret Tent to the Melbourne Comedy Festival. That personal story behind his start has never stopped him building a genuinely national and international profile.
Television and broadcast credits include the BBC's The Stand-Up Show, Paramount's The World Stands Up, and Comics Lounge in Australia. He also runs his own promotion brand, Gag N Bone Man Comedy, putting on nights and giving stage time to other acts coming up through the circuit behind him. He was a finalist in the 2025 Halifax Comedian of the Year competition as well as a former British Comedian of the Year semi-finalist, results that reflect years of consistently strong material and stagecraft built up show after show.
